The Physics of Rotation and Its Impact on Performance
The application of spin isnāt simply about making an object rotate; itās about harnessing aerodynamic forces. Understanding how spin interacts with air currents is crucial. Backspin, for instance, creates a pressure difference that lifts the object, increasing its flight time and reducing its landing angle. Conversely, topspin creates downward force, causing a steeper descent and a quicker bounce. Sidespin, naturally, introduces lateral movement, throwing off an opponent's anticipation and making accurate interception far more difficult. Controlling these forces requires a deep understanding of Bernoulliās principle and the Magnus effect, which explains the force acting on a rotating object in a fluid medium. This understanding isnāt limited to the professional level; even amateur athletes can significantly improve their game by grasping these fundamental concepts. The ability to visualize the trajectory and predict the effect of spin is a hallmark of a skilled player.
Practical Applications in Different Sports
Consider the differences in spin application across various disciplines. In tennis, a topspin-heavy shot allows for aggressive net play, while a slice, employing backspin, can disrupt an opponentās rhythm. Baseball pitchers exploit the Magnus effect to create breaking balls ā curves, sliders, and screwballs ā that deceive batters. Golfers utilize backspin to stop the ball quickly on the green, enabling precise putting. Even in sports like swimming and diving, subtle body rotations influence technique and efficiency. Each sport demands a specialized approach to spin, tailored to the unique dynamics and objectives of the game. This specialization often requires dedicated coaching and countless hours of practice to refine the required technique. It highlights that a āone size fits allā approach to the skill is ineffective.
| Sport | Spin Type Commonly Used | Effect |
|---|---|---|
| Tennis | Topspin, Backspin, Sidespin | Aggressive net play, disruption of rhythm, lateral movement |
| Baseball | Various (Curveball, Slider, Screwball) | Deception of batters, altering trajectory |
| Golf | Backspin | Quick stopping on the green, precise putting |
| Swimming/Diving | Body Rotation | Improved technique, enhanced efficiency |
The table illustrates just a snapshot of how integral understanding and applying controlled spin can be. Mastering these techniques is a continuous journey of refinement and adaptation.
Developing the Feel: Muscle Memory and Proprioception
While understanding the physics of spin is important, itās not sufficient to achieve mastery. The truly exceptional practitioners possess a āfeelā for the technique ā an intuitive understanding of how much force and rotation are required to achieve the desired effect. This 'feel' develops through repetition, building muscle memory and enhancing proprioception, which is the body's ability to sense its position and movement in space. Hundreds, even thousands, of repetitions are needed to ingrain the correct motor patterns into the nervous system. This process isn't about mindless repetition, however; it's about mindful practice, focusing on precision and consistency with each repetition. Feedback from coaches, video analysis, and self-assessment are essential components of this development process.
The Role of Mental Visualization
Equally important is the ability to visualize the desired outcome. Mental rehearsal ā vividly imagining the perfect execution of a technique ā can activate the same neural pathways as physical practice, enhancing performance and accelerating learning. This mental practice can be particularly beneficial in situations where physical practice is limited or unavailable. Elite athletes consistently use mental visualization as a tool to prepare for competition and maintain peak performance. It isnāt just about seeing the ball curve or the golf ball stop; itās about feeling the grip, the swing, the release ā truly immersing oneself in the experience. This holistic approach to training amplifies the impact of physical practice, leading to more rapid and sustainable improvement.

The Strategic Dimension: Deception and Adaptation
Skillful application of spin isnāt solely about executing a technically perfect technique; itās also about using it strategically to deceive opponents and gain a competitive advantage. Varying the amount and type of spin can disrupt an opponentās timing and anticipation, forcing them to react instead of proactively preparing. The element of surprise is a powerful weapon. The best players donāt telegraph their intentions; they maintain a deceptive posture and release point, making it difficult for opponents to read their shots. This strategic dimension requires a deep understanding of the opponentās weaknesses and tendencies, as well as the ability to adapt oneās technique to exploit those vulnerabilities. Itās a constant game of cat and mouse, a mental duel waged alongside the physical contest.
Reading Your Opponent and Adjusting Strategy
Successfully manipulating spin also requires keen observational skills. Learning to read an opponentās body language, anticipate their movements, and identify their patterns of play is crucial. This information can be used to adjust oneās own strategy, varying spin types, placement, and speed to keep the opponent off balance. Adaptability is paramount. What works against one opponent may not work against another. The ability to quickly assess the situation and make appropriate adjustments is a hallmark of a truly gifted athlete. Itās a constant process of learning, adapting, and refining oneās approach based on the specific challenges presented by the competition.

The Modern Spin King: Data Analysis and Technological Advancement
Today, the pursuit of exceptional control, the journey to become a āspin kingā is increasingly informed by data analysis and technological advancements. High-speed cameras, motion capture technology, and advanced statistical models provide athletes and coaches with unprecedented insights into technique and performance. These tools can be used to identify subtle flaws in form, optimize spin rates, and develop customized training programs. The integration of wearable sensors allows for real-time monitoring of biomechanical data, providing immediate feedback and enabling adjustments on the fly. While technology enhances the process, it's crucial to remember that itās merely a tool. The fundamental principles of practice, dedication, and strategic thinking remain paramount. Technology amplifies these existing traits, but cannot replace them.
